The Jaipur bracelet is made on the basis of a cord that offers you all the possibilities. It is indeed possible to customize your bracelet as you wish, since it is possible to attach to the cord the beads and elements of your choice! The hardest part will be to choose.

Cut 16 cm of cord. Wrap each end of orange thread, about a cm, tightening to fit the creation in the cup. Make a knot and hide it.
Put glue in each end of closure then glue and let dry well.

Add a ring on each side, slide them into the screw clasp. (Adjust to your wrist size by adding a ring if necessary).

Locate the middle of the cord, mark it with a pin or a thin pencil line. Wrap the orange thread loosely on both sides for two cm. Cut the thread and hide the two ends by securing them with a small invisible stitch if you wish.

Sew an interlayer as a central element. Have fun by adding, according to your desire, rounds of seed beads. Then thread 26 beads, surround the cord, make a knot and then iron several times in the ring obtained, fix to the bracelet by a stitch, make the thread stand out and cut the surplus.

For the ginko pearl ring: thread 2 seed beads, one pearl, repeat 5 times. Surround the cord where you want to place this element then pass the needle in the hole of a ginko pearl, add two seed beads, repeat 5 times. Iron several times to consolidate.
You can sew here and there some rocks.
It's already finished !
